Transaction 84b34fb3b42a36210ffca6ebfb76d838facd32c26189678072a8b68f87a4b5c0
2 Input
2 Outputs
- 84b34fb3b42a36210ffca6ebfb76d838facd32c26189678072a8b68f87a4b5c0:0
- 84b34fb3b42a36210ffca6ebfb76d838facd32c26189678072a8b68f87a4b5c0:1
value 7684
address 14PDvrLK81TzYQ165DLdy2DStiyZ1x5uFo
value 14079
address 3DtfACxbFWJ8KTB6xS4Paq1jcnzdpn6AMR